This blurb is from the VS.NET 2003 readme, but the same should apply to
VS.NET as well.



5.25. Failure of FrontPage 2000 Web Client Extensions Installation


A typical installation of Visual Studio .NET 2003 installs FrontPage 2000
Web Client Extensions from the Visual Studio .NET 2003 Prerequisites CD. In
some instances, installation of FrontPage 2000 Web Client Extensions may
fail. Consequently, you might need to install FrontPage 2000 Web Client
Extensions directly.

To resolve this issue

Insert the Visual Studio .NET 2003 Prerequisites CD.
On the Windows Start menu, click Run, and type [CD Drive]:\weccom.msi
Follow the directions in the FrontPage 2000 Web Client Extensions setup
dialog box.


On Windows XP Home Edition:

Setup may prompt for the Windows XP Professional Edition CD. Insert either
the Windows XP Home Edition or the Windows XP Professional Edition CD.



On Windows XP Home Edition or Windows XP Professional Edition with Service
Pack 1 installed:

Setup may prompt for the Windows XP SP1 CD. Insert the Windows XP Operating
System CD rather than the SP1 CD when prompted for operating system source
media.

Note For an OEM version of the operating system, copy files from the
installation CD to a local destination:
Copy Fp4autl.dll, Fpencode.dll, and Fp4awel.dll from \i386\Fp40ext.cab.
To [Local drive]:\Program Files\Common Files\Microsoft Shared\Web Server
Extensions\40\bin.
